One of the most crucial parts of the IVF process is the growth and development of embryos. Often, the success rate of IVF depends on the number of embryos that make it to day 5 and are called blastocysts. But how many fertilized eggs typically reach this stage?

The number of fertilized eggs that reach day 5 can vary depending on various factors such as age, genetics, and environmental factors. However, on average, about 40-50% of fertilized eggs make it to day 5 and ultimately result in a successful pregnancy. It is important to remember that every IVF journey is unique, and success rates can vary depending on individual circumstances and factors. 1. Quality of the eggs

The quality of the eggs is a crucial factor that affects their survival until day 5. In some cases, the eggs may be of poor quality, and some may not even be fertilized. Poor quality eggs can lead to poor cell division, which ultimately affects the development of the embryos. Additionally, eggs that are not properly matured or aged may not have the necessary components to support the embryos, reducing the number of viable embryos.

2. Sperm quality and quantity

Sperm quality and quantity are also important factors in the journey of fertilization. Poor quality sperm can affect the ability of an egg to fertilize. Reduced sperm count can lead to fewer fertilized eggs and a reduction in the number of embryos that survive until day 5.

3. Age of the woman

The age of the woman is a major factor that determines the number of fertilized eggs that make it to day 5. As women age, their egg quality and quantity decrease, reducing the chances of fertilization and successful embryo development. Consequently, women who are younger will have higher chances of success.

6. Genetic factors

Genetic factors can also affect the success rate of fertilized eggs. In some cases, the embryos may have chromosomal abnormalities, which reduce the chances of survival until day 5. Genetic testing can be done to identify such abnormalities and increase the chances of successful implantation.

Factors that Impact Embryo Development Until Day 5

When it comes to determining how many fertilized eggs make it to day 5, it’s important to keep in mind that various factors can impact embryo development during these crucial days. Here are ten factors that can influence embryo development until day 5:

1. Quality of the Embryos

Undoubtedly, the quality of the embryos has a significant impact on their development until day 5. If the embryos are of high quality, they have a better chance of developing healthy and reaching the blastocyst stage. Conversely, if they’re poor quality, it may result in a lower success rate of embryos making it to day 5.

2. Age of the Eggs and Sperm

The age of both the eggs and sperm can also impact the development of embryos until day 5. The eggs and sperm of younger individuals typically have a better chance of developing quality embryos that can make it to the blastocyst stage.

3. Fertilization Method

The fertilization method used can also influence embryo development until day 5. For instance, IVF (In vitro fertilization) has a higher success rate of embryos making it to the blastocyst stage than IUI (Intrauterine insemination) or natural fertilization.

4. Embryo Culture Conditions

The conditions under which the embryos are cultured also impact their development until day 5. The culture medium and incubator parameters, such as temperature and gas concentrations, are critical factors that can affect the growth and quality of the embryos.

5. Chromosomal Abnormalities

Chromosomal abnormalities are a common issue in embryos that can impact their development. Embryos with chromosomal abnormalities typically have a lower chance of reaching the blastocyst stage.

Section 3: Factors Affecting Embryo Development

1. Maternal Age

One of the most significant factors that can affect the development of embryos is the age of the woman producing them. As women age, the quality of their eggs declines, which can lead to a higher incidence of chromosomal abnormalities and an increased risk of miscarriage. Women over the age of 35 are particularly at risk, with a decline in the number of eggs and an increase in the likelihood of chromosomal defects.

2. Sperm Quality

The quality of the sperm used in the fertilization process can also have an impact on the development of embryos. Poor quality sperm can lead to abnormalities in the fertilized egg, which can result in implantation failure, a failed pregnancy, or developmental issues. Factors that can affect sperm quality include age, lifestyle, exposure to toxins, and genetics.

3. Genetic Abnormalities

Genetic abnormalities in either the egg or sperm can lead to issues with embryo development. These abnormalities can be inherited or acquired during the production of the egg or sperm. Some of the most common genetic abnormalities include Down syndrome, Turner syndrome, and Klinefelter syndrome. It’s important to note that not all genetic abnormalities result in a failed embryo, and some abnormalities may be compatible with life.

4. Environmental Factors

Environmental factors can also have an impact on embryo development. Exposure to toxins and pollutants, such as cigarette smoke, drugs, and alcohol, can affect the health of the developing embryo. Infections, such as rubella and sexually transmitted infections, can also lead to developmental issues. It’s important to maintain a healthy lifestyle and seek medical attention for any infections or illnesses during pregnancy.

5. Laboratory Conditions

Finally, the conditions within the laboratory can also affect the development of embryos. The quality of the culture medium and the incubation environment can impact the growth and development of the embryos. Careful monitoring and maintenance of the laboratory environment are essential to ensure the best possible outcomes for embryo development.
